Flying in the face of criminalization : the safety implications of prosecuting aviation professionals for accidents
Flying in the face of criminalization : the safety implications of prosecuting aviation professionals for accidents is a book. It was written by Sofia Michaelides-Mateou and published by Ashgate in 2010.
